The game is played by having each family member take turns completing a particular challenge in a given category, either alone, with a partner, or against an opponent.  There are five different categories, like “Meat-N-Greet,” “Say Cheese,” and “Lettuce Play.”  Challenges include things like “Name 5 foods that start with the letter ‘W,” “Close your eyes and name 10 things on the table,” and “Perform a dramatic opera about tacos for 45 seconds.”  The player to complete a challenge in each of the five categories is crowned El Tacodor.
